Is Tokamak Network coin worth investing in?
Tokamak Network's innovative PLAAS model and focus on environmental sustainability position it as a strong investment candidate in the rapidly expanding decentralized computing industry.
Dec 27, 2024 at 03:56 pm

Key Points:
- Deep dive into Tokamak Network's technology and platform
- Comprehensive analysis of tokenomics and market dynamics
- Assessment of competitive landscape and growth potential
Detailed Analysis:
1. Technology and Platform:
- Tokamak Network spearheads a groundbreaking proof-of-work (PoW) blockchain that incorporates a novel "power-as-a-service" (PLAAS) model.
- PLAAS enables users to rent out their computing power, creating a decentralized network of computing nodes without the need for dedicated mining hardware.
- This decentralized approach enhances scalability, efficiency, and resilience while reducing energy consumption, addressing concerns highlighted by traditional PoW systems.
2. Tokenomics and Market Dynamics:
TOK, the native token of Tokamak Network, serves multiple functions:
- Payment for network transaction fees
- Reward for PLAAS participants
- Governance token for protocol decision-making
- Token distribution is designed to incentivize node operators and long-term holders, contributing to a balanced and sustainable ecosystem.
- The market capitalization of TOK has experienced significant growth, reflecting investor confidence in the network's potential.
3. Competitive Landscape and Growth Potential:
- Tokamak Network competes in the decentralized computing market, challenged by established players like Golem and Filecoin.
- However, its unique PLAAS model and focus on reducing environmental footprint provide competitive advantages.
- Partnerships with leading cloud service providers and blockchain projects indicate a promising growth trajectory.
4. Investment Considerations:
- The potential for mass adoption of decentralized computing technologies holds promise for Tokamak Network.
- Long-term investors should assess the regulatory landscape and the evolution of competing platforms before making investment decisions.
- Volatility in the cryptocurrency market and changes in network dynamics pose risks that investors should consider.
5. Assessment of Worthiness:
Based on the comprehensive analysis above, Tokamak Network exhibits several attributes that support its investment potential:
- Innovative and disruptive technology
- Strong tokenomics and market dynamics
- Competent team and strategic Partnerships
- High-growth potential
- While volatility remains a concern, long-term investors who understand the risks and embrace the potential of decentralized computing may consider Tokamak Network a promising investment.
FAQs:
Q: What is the unique value proposition of Tokamak Network?
A: Its "power-as-a-service" (PLAAS) model enables decentralized computing without dedicated mining hardware, reducing energy consumption and enhancing scalability and resilience.
Q: How does PLAAS work?
A: Users rent out their computing power to participate in the network, receiving rewards in TOK and contributing to a decentralized, efficient network.
Q: What are the key drivers of TOK's market dynamics?
A: Adoption of PLAAS and decentralized computing technologies, tokenomics designed to incentivize long-term holders, and partnerships with established players.
Q: What are the risks associated with investing in Tokamak Network?
A: As with all cryptocurrency investments, volatility in the market and changes in network dynamics can pose risks. Regulatory uncertainties should also be considered.
Q: Who are the potential long-term investors in Tokamak Network?
A: Savvy investors who understand the risks and rewards of cryptocurrency investments and recognize the potential of disruptive technologies like decentralized computing.
